Job Description: **Administrative Assistant – Mindplace** **Mindplace Peterborough,** **Serpentine Green Hargate Way, Hampton, Peterborough, PE7 8BE ** **Permanent. Full time, 37.5 hours.** _**Hours will consist of a combination of weekday shifts 2pm-10pm and at least one shift over the weekend Sat 9am-5pm or Sun 11am-5pm with some flexibility to cover day shifts as required**_ **£27,900 per annum plus excellent benefits** We believe caring for your mind should feel as natural as caring for your body. That’s why we’re creating dedicated spaces with expert face-to-face support, grounded in nearly 80 years of trusted Bupa care. As an employee at Bupa, our patients will be your top priority. With no shareholders, we reinvest our profits back into our business to give you the extra time and technology you need to make a difference to our patients every day. **We make health happen** We are looking for a dedicated individual to efficiently and effectively manage all administrative and receptionist activities. This role is essential for the smooth operation of our centre and is crucial in providing outstanding customer service. You will be a key support network, ensuring that every interaction with our customers, both adults and children, is special and memorable. Your commitment to excellent service will help create positive experiences for everyone who visits us. **You’ll help us make health happen by:** * Greeting and welcoming customers in addition to supporting the customer journey throughout the centre right through to a thorough checkout • Answering, screening and forwarding incoming customer queries via phone calls and proactively managing local mailbox and emails • Proactive in maintaining a well presented reception and waiting areas • Ensuring customer reports are dispatched from centres within the desired time frame. This includes effective management of abnormal results • Ensure all customers have the correct paperwork to support their visit – appointment pack
